mdsk.net
当前位置:首页 >> 如何在wEB.xml中配置springmvC >>

如何在wEB.xml中配置springmvC

:先帮助你理清几个概念: (1)web.xml是J2EE用来描述web工程的描述文件,在里面可配置servelet filter listener 等,应用服务器根据此配置响应用户的请求,spring和它无直接关系; (2)spring总共包含两个概念:AOP(切面编程)和IOC(控制反转),

contextConfigLocation classpath:spring-config.xml spring3MvcDispatcher org.springframework.web.servlet.DispatcherServlet contextConfigLocation classpath:spring-servlet.xml 1

<context-param>标签的意思当然是初始化启动了.classpath:applicationContext.xml的意思就是从classpath:路径中找到SPRING的配置文件并加载上..classpath:也可以改成/WEB-INF/.就看配置文件放哪了监听器会帮你新建BeanFactory接口的实例.然后就可以大胆的用IOC了.SPRING中配置的依赖关系都会生效.

<servlet> <servlet-name>demo_project</servlet-name> <servlet-class>org.springframework.web.servlet.DispatcherServlet</servlet-class> <init-param> <param-name>contextConfigLocation</param-name> <param-value>classpath*:/resources/

import java.util.Random; public class ArraySort { public static void main(String[] args){ int temp=0; int myarr[] = new int[12];Random r=new Random(); for(int i=1;imyarr[k]){

自动生成的默认是调用你jdk相关jar包的内容,基本没有影响,只是spring支持需要的.

使用spring mvc,配置dispatcherservlet是第一步.dispatcherservlet是一个servlet,所以可以配置多个dispatcherservlet.dispatcherservlet是前置控制器,配置在web.xml文件中的.拦截匹配的请求,servlet拦截匹配规则要自已定义,把拦截下来的请求,依据某某规则分发到目标controller(我们写的action)来处理.“某某规则”:是根据你使用了哪个handlermapping接口的实现类的不同而不同.

securityfiltercom.analytics.common.filter.securityfilterchecksessionkeyuserredirecturl/login/img/*,/resource/* 不需要过滤的目录,目前只支持一级目录.uri可以写多个;号隔开notcheckurllist/img/*;/resource/*;/loginsecurityfilter*.jspsecurityfilter*filter加一个notcheckurllist就可以了,具体目录是下边这样的 /img/*;/resource/*;/login

web.xml是在服务器启动的时候调用的,在J2EE工程中,是最先调用,上面这段配置的意思是,加载spring的监听器ContextLoaderListener来读取applicationContext.xml里的配置

本经验教你一步一步使用maven搭建springmvc开发环境,最后一步有最终的项目结构图方法/步骤使用eclipse新建maven项目生成的目录没有src/main/java,直接右键,new-folder,会自动变成sourcefolder步骤阅读修改pom文件4.0.2.release4.11junitjunit${junit.version}org.springframeworkspring-webmvc${spring.version}

网站首页 | 网站地图
All rights reserved Powered by www.mdsk.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com